Help with College food
All right, i'm facing a diet dilema in college now. First, the food at my cafeteria has a limited selection. Breakfast is usually 5 scrambled eggs with ham and cheese or those fake eggs they poor out of box, bowl of cherios or grapenuts with skim milk, and a side of cantelope. Lunch, i'm usually limited to turkey sandwichs, Pasta, PB&J or cereal again. everyday they have snack time when they offer steak(chopped up hamburger patty) and cheese which i get once or twice a weak to keep my calories up during the day. Dinner is the usually the same as lunch but sometimes they offer roastbeef. the school food is loaded with sat fats and sugars and I think i'm relying on to much protein from my shakes and not getting enough quality food that has a high BV. My other meals throughout the day include a turkey sandwich i sneak out from the caf or eat a protein bar(wasnt aware how bad they can be if you eat to many). My question is what do you guys do up at college to maintain a lean diet. Shaws market is 20 minutes from the school so i think i need to start shopping on my own to make more progress in the gym. Unfortunately Tuna is out of the question, i cant stomach that stuff, i know how great of a source it is for protein but i dont have the power.
